#557191 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#557191 is composed of 33.3% red, 44.3%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.4%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 212 degrees, a saturation of 26.1% and a lightness of 45.1%. #557191 color hex could be obtained by blending #aae2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#557191 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#557191 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#557191 has RGB values of R:85, G:113,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 5599633.

Shades and Tints of #557191
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050709 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#557191
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707376 is the less saturated color, while #056ce1 is the most saturated one.
